Reggio Calabria
Nestled on the sea facing Sicily, Reggio Calabria is a city that surprises with its seafront, described as "the most beautiful in Italy," its breathtaking view of Mount Etna, and its rich archaeological heritage. It is the birthplace of the famous Riace Bronzes, housed in the National Archaeological Museum. The city lives in contrasts: between the palm trees along the seafront, the ruins of the Greek polis, the Liberty-style architecture of the buildings, and the modern vitality of its people.

Scilla
Perched between the sea and the mountains, Scilla is one of the most charming villages in the Mediterranean. The Chianalea fishermen's district, with houses built on the rocks, offers a timeless atmosphere, while the beach and the Ruffo Castle dominate the coastline from above.
